Deana Mattos Diefenbach

Deana Diefenbach’s passions interconnects like a patchwork quilt. Painting, crafting, upcycling, collecting and caregiving are all seamed together. Finding the flow that connects them all, from the personal to the professional, is her daily goal. 

Deana’s painterly style is loose and contemporary, with a fondness for bold color and intuitive marks, capturing the fleeting essence of a moment. Deana enjoys working with a wide range of mediums from acrylic paints on canvas to watercolors on paper, to mixed media/collage and unique upcycled projects. Her subjects are inspired by the natural beauty of the scenery of Montana where she lives. The inspiration comes from the wildlife, landscapes, birds and the flowers of her own garden. She loves the freedom and release of working abstractly. As she works on a subject, abstraction always plays a role to show her unique vision and perspective. 

Home is where the heART is and that’s where Deana creates her own paradise. It is a necessity due to her own newly discovered chronic illness, as well as raising a child that has severe disabilities. Deana is an avid collector of beautiful things and a master thrifter. She loves the beauty of design, good quality and has a keen aesthetic and eye for both. Collecting and reselling these treasures is a joy, alongside painting, and it keeps her home and wardrobe looking like a rotating museum. Her work and sales help aid in providing for her family by reselling some of the best of her finds. In the warmer months, she loves to tend to her beautiful gardens and enjoys spending time in the camper she renovated into an artist’s “glamper” aka her studio.

Deana lives with her family of five in rural Montana with mountains in clear view.
